Output 87fc4cecdeb11cb52cb4bdffb9929bef90f4116e893b9e89a092a2c8ffb4e89f:1

value
75398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ff37d020b2f4fe921bf77996c5a34bea5daf84 OP_EQUAL
address
359vfVySiuw4u1d6Hr4kTQLxDv8eQdUfcA
transaction
87fc4cecdeb11cb52cb4bdffb9929bef90f4116e893b9e89a092a2c8ffb4e89f
confirmations
215771
spent
true